Output d8e45bb1831b7d562bc652fe0eb18e6907a09c8f16ecd85ce92f7146dae4e828:0

value
476905
script pubkey
OP_0 OP_PUSHBYTES_20 58bafcb469651173ce75e754f6af448e1798bda8
address
bc1qtza0edrfv5gh8nn4ua20dt6y3cte30dgjf0wyt
transaction
d8e45bb1831b7d562bc652fe0eb18e6907a09c8f16ecd85ce92f7146dae4e828
confirmations
52281
spent
true